HENDERSONVILLE, Tenn. Police said a 90-year-old man in
Sumner County put up a fight after three women attempted
to rob him Monday.

The incident occurred outside the Verizon store on Indian
Lake Boulevard just before noon.

Hendersonville police said three women followed the
elderly man to t
he
store and held him up with a gun when he got out of his
car.

The man knocked the weapon out of one of the robbers
hands, grabbed it and ran into the store.

Several people saw the incident and were able to give
police a detailed report of the robbers and their car.
